Locating Gold Prospecting Spots This is one of the most important actions to be taken because our success will depend on this research. One of the first steps is an extensive consultation of the LNEG website, www.lneg.pt Here you can see the mineralogy of the Portuguese territory, the prospecting that has been done in our territory with its results, and mining explorations. It is important information but not crucial, as there may be regions that are not identified as having a certain mineral, but it does exist; it has happened to me. Consulting Google Maps is extremely important; it gives us an overview of the territory we want to explore and allows us to decide more reliably which areas to prospect. This is not very linear, since with field exploration I have come across many good places that you can't see on Google Maps because the vegetation is dense. After these steps, it's time to go to the field and look for areas of gold retention and deposition.
